系统可视化平台如何实现数据实时更新?
随着大数据时代的到来,企业对数据的依赖程度越来越高。为了更好地管理和分析数据,系统可视化平台应运而生。然而,如何实现数据实时更新,成为了许多企业关注的焦点。本文将围绕这一主题,探讨系统可视化平台如何实现数据实时更新。
一、系统可视化平台实现数据实时更新的重要性
1. 提高决策效率
在当今快节奏的商业环境中,实时数据对于企业决策至关重要。通过实时更新数据,企业可以快速了解市场动态,及时调整经营策略,提高决策效率。
2. 优化资源配置
实时数据可以帮助企业实时监控资源使用情况,合理调配资源,降低成本,提高资源利用率。
3. 预测未来趋势
通过对实时数据的分析,企业可以预测未来市场趋势,为战略规划提供有力支持。
二、系统可视化平台实现数据实时更新的技术手段
1. 数据采集
数据采集是数据实时更新的基础。系统可视化平台可以通过以下方式采集数据:
- 数据库连接:通过数据库连接,实时获取数据库中的数据。
- API接口:通过调用第三方API接口,获取实时数据。
- 传感器:利用传感器实时采集现场数据。
2. 数据处理
数据采集后,需要进行处理,以便在可视化平台上展示。数据处理主要包括以下步骤:
- 数据清洗:去除无效、错误的数据,保证数据质量。
- 数据转换:将数据转换为可视化平台所需的格式。
- 数据聚合:对数据进行汇总、统计,以便在可视化平台上展示。
3. 数据展示
数据展示是系统可视化平台的核心功能。以下是一些常用的数据展示方式:
- 图表:通过图表展示数据趋势、分布等。
- 地图:通过地图展示地理位置信息。
- 仪表盘:通过仪表盘实时监控关键指标。
4. 数据实时更新
为了实现数据实时更新,系统可视化平台需要采用以下技术:
- WebSocket:通过WebSocket技术,实现服务器与客户端之间的实时通信。
- 定时任务:通过定时任务,定期刷新数据。
- 消息队列:通过消息队列,实现数据的异步处理。
三、案例分析
1. 某电商平台
某电商平台通过系统可视化平台实时监控销售数据、库存数据等,实现了对业务的全面掌控。通过实时数据,平台可以快速调整库存策略,提高销售额。
2. 某制造企业
某制造企业通过系统可视化平台实时监控生产数据、设备状态等,实现了对生产过程的实时监控。通过实时数据,企业可以及时发现生产问题,提高生产效率。
四、总结
系统可视化平台实现数据实时更新,对于企业来说具有重要意义。通过采用合适的技术手段,企业可以实现数据的实时采集、处理和展示,从而提高决策效率、优化资源配置、预测未来趋势。
猜你喜欢:服务调用链